Subject: misc/28521: OpenFirmware 2.0.3 is overwriteable
To: None <misc-bug-people@netbsd.org, gnats-admin@netbsd.org,>
From: None <majidf+nbsdpr@watson.org>
List: netbsd-bugs
Date: 12/03/2004 04:42:00
>Number:         28521
>Category:       misc
>Synopsis:       OpenFirmware 2.0.3 is overwriteable
>Confidential:   no
>Severity:       critical
>Priority:       high
>Responsible:    misc-bug-people
>State:          open
>Class:          doc-bug
>Submitter-Id:   net
>Arrival-Date:   Fri Dec 03 04:42:00 +0000 2004
>Originator:     Majid
>Release:        N/A
>Organization:
Independent
>Environment:
N/A
>Description:
It is possible to overwrite the openfirmware version 2.0.3 contrary to what the MacPPC documentation says (which says version 3 is overwriteable). So it should be changed saying that lower versions such as 2.0.3 is overwriteable on some computers (the one I overwrote was version 2.0.3 on a Performa 5500/225).

Regards

>How-To-Repeat:
(Warning this repetition will definitivly overwrite your OFW 2.0.3 on Performa 5500/225)
setenv real-base F0000000
setenv load-base 60000000

boot fd:,ofwboot.xcf


>Fix:
Avoid playing around in sensitive stuff and follow the docs precisly =)